Character interpretation

Front, side and back views become pattern, proportion and expression checkpoints.

Decoration detail

Embroidery, appliqué, printing, clothing and accessories are sampled at production scale.

Prototype control

Revision notes compare dimensions, symmetry, face placement, color and construction against artwork.

Packaging

Hangtags, labels, polybags, display boxes, cartons and ecommerce protection enter the pack-out plan.

Mass-production QC

Materials, cutting, sewing, filling, finishing, needle control, inspection and pack-out follow the golden sample.

Approval-led process

Know what each stage must prove.

The next stage starts only when the current product decision is documented well enough to protect cost, quality and schedule.

  1. Artwork review

    Identify missing views, proportion risks, materials and production constraints.

  2. Pattern and first sample

    Translate the character into a physical form and record the first comparison.

  3. Revision and golden sample

    Correct shape, expression, color, hand feel, decoration and packaging.

  4. Pilot and quality plan

    Confirm materials, workmanship checks, tolerances and pack-out.

  5. Mass production

    Control incoming materials, sewing, filling, finishing, inspection and cartons.

    Questions before the first review

    Can you work from one sketch?

    Yes, but the first stage may include clarification of side/back views, dimensions, colors and hidden construction before an accurate sample scope.

    How many sample revisions are typical?

    It depends on artwork completeness and character complexity. The key is to define revision rounds and measurable approval criteria before sampling.

    Can you match a specific fabric?

    Share the reference or physical sample. The team can propose swatches and confirm color, pile, stretch, backing and hand feel against the intended result.

    Common question

    how much does it cost to make a custom plush toy

    This site does not publish unit prices, because plush cost moves with finished height, fabric, filling, decoration method, accessories, packaging and order quantity. A reference image on its own does not define any of those, which is why the first step is a measurable specification rather than a number. Set the finished height, primary material, decoration methods and packaging direction in the specification builder, and you get a first-pass spec we can actually quote. Quantity, market and launch schedule then determine the real figure.
